Key Aspects to Consider
Before drafting your request, ensure you include relevant details such as the reason for the assistance, the amount requested, and how you plan to repay the funds. Clarity and transparency are crucial, as they will help the recipient understand your situation and assess your reliability.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id
One of the most frequent mistakes in these types of documents is providing too little or too much information. Be concise but thorough in your explanation. Avoid unnecessary emotional appeals or vague statements, and focus on your financial responsibility and the clear steps you’re taking to fulfill your obligations.
Increasing Your Approval Chances: Tailor your request to highlight your strengths, such as your ability to repay or any assets you might have. A well-crafted, realistic approach will demonstrate your responsibility and increase your likelihood of approval.
